#589381 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#589381 is composed of 34.5% red, 57.6%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 12.2%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 161.7 degrees, a saturation of 25.1% and a lightness of 46.1%. #589381 color hex could be obtained by blending #b0ffff with #002703.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

#589381 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#589381 has RGB values of R:88, G:147, B:129 and CMYK values of C:0.4, M:0, Y:0.12,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 5804929.

Shades and Tints of #589381
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070c0b is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
